JetBlue Aims to Lift Fliers Above Industry’s Hassles


NEW YORK (AdAge.com) — As tempers flare over airlines' delays, fare hikes and fewer free services, JetBlue wants to put a more pleasant spin on air travel with its new marketing theme, "Happy Jetting." Andrea Spiegel, VP-marketing at JetBlue, explained in an Ad Age interview that the "need for optimism and a positive alternative in this negative category is more important than ever."

Automakers are revving up for movie theater ads

After a long hiatus from the movie theaters for no good reason, I’ve returned, seeing several pre-summer blockbusters in the past few weeks. One thing, in particular, that’s stuck out in my mind has been a definitely noticable increase in ads, with a surprising number of auto makers pushing for my attention (albeit my attention is pretty much on the screen regardless).

As several articles I’ve been browsing through today point out, my perception of an increase in theater ads isn’t just my imagination. A pretty interesting AdAge article by Jean Halliday points out that movie theater ad sales are quickly rising across the board, capturing the attention of auto makers:

Screenvision’s revenue in the segment for the first half of 2008 is almost double what it was in the first half of 2007, said exec VP-sales and marketing Mike Chico, who said he expects to sell out 2008 inventory in the third quarter, which is unusual.

Which basically translates into more high profile ads showing up in theaters, and more interesting creative being done in longer formats, like the full :60 version of the Dodge Journey waterslide spot that’s been all over broadcast TV (in :30 form) of late.
So while part of me is tossin’ back the popcorn waiting impatiently for the movie to start, the other part of me is glad that big-budget advertisers (and the subsequent big-budget ads) are going to be showing up more and more in the theaters. Because while I’m a captive audience starting blankly at a mind-numbing screen, there might as well be something enjoyable for me to stare at.

Sierra Mist Looks to ‘Get Smart’


LOS ANGELES (AdAge.com) — That most disposable artifact of pop culture, the summer movie, has finally met its match: the summer-only brand. On June 20, Warner Bros. Pictures' remake of the spy spoof "Get Smart" will pop into theaters preceded by a multimillion-dollar promotional push from PepsiCo's limited-edition Sierra Mist Undercover Orange soda.

Eco-Friendly Singaporean Architecture – Beach Road Complex (GALLERY)

(TrendHunter.com) The prestigious architecture firm Foster and Partners have won an international competition to design a highly sustainable mixed use complex for Beach Road in Singapore. Occupying an entire city block, they will create a 150,000 square meter ecologically-friendly quarter in downtown Singapore with c…
